We serve clients from a wide range of industries that depend on technology for their business success. Our clients include internet software developers, integrated manufacturers, national management consulting firms, major internet providers, telecommunications providers, financial institutions, insurance companies and electronic bill presentment and payment companies. Our Emerging Technologies lawyers collaborate with lawyers from our other practice groups to leverage their knowledge and experience and to bring the most appropriate legal team to address our clients’ specific legal needs.
